President’s Message Message from the President
We want to be a service company that creates the future of “life” and “travel” for customers.
Our company was established in 2000 as a company of the JR West Group, originating from the Kiosk station and the convenience store "Heart-in", and provides products and services to customers who use the station for everyday "life" and "travel" for commuting and going to school.
As the needs of our customers change every moment due to changes in the social environment and other factors, the products and services we require are diversifying. In our main businesses, the CVS business, the souvenir business, the tenant business, and the beverage vending machine curico business, we have been working to respond to various changes, including the implementation of various sales measures and business alliances in cooperation with our business partners, but in order to further enhance customer value, we are also pursuing new challenges beyond our existing business domains, such as entering the craft beer business and fitness gym business and developing unmanned vending machines.
From now on, for customers.
With safety and security as the top priority, we aim to be a company that continues to take on challenges in cooperation with various stakeholders.
In addition, the business of the hotel specializing in accommodation was succeeded on April 1, 2025 to JR West Via Inn Co., Ltd., which entrusted the operation of the Via Inn Hotel.
